Check Digit Verification of cas no

The CAS Registry Mumber 5705-61-3 includes 7 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 4 digits, 5,7,0 and 5 respectively; the second part has 2 digits, 6 and 1 respectively.
Calculate Digit Verification of CAS Registry Number 5705-61:
(6*5)+(5*7)+(4*0)+(3*5)+(2*6)+(1*1)=93
93 % 10 = 3
So 5705-61-3 is a valid CAS Registry Number.

A Simple Synthesis of Natural Products with 5-H-Furan-2-on Structure

Reisch, Johannes,Mester, Zita

, p. 635 - 638 (1983)

Starting from an aldehyde, γ-Yliden-α,β-butenolides were synthesised simply by the use of 2,5-dihydro-2,5-dimethoxyfuran in the presence of trimethylchlorosilane. - Keywords: 2,5-Dihydro-2,5-dimethoxyfuran, γ-Yliden-α,β-butenolide

A NEW SYNTHESIS OF 5-METHYLENE-2(5H)-FURANONE DERIVATIVES

Antonioletti, Roberto,D'Auria, Maurizio,Mico, Antonella De,Piancatelli, Giovanni,Scettri, Arrigo

, p. 3805 - 3808 (2007/10/02)

5-methylene-2(5H)-furanone derivatives are easily obtained by treatment of tertiary 2-furylcarbinols with pyridinium dichromate in dimethylformamide solution.Through this procedure, a natural product, the thiophene lactone, isolated from Chamaemelum Nobile L., has been synthesized.
